High Risk ECG Patterns You Can't Miss Webinar

In this hour webinar lecture, we will review 3 high risk ECG patterns that are predictive of ACS: Wellens Waves, DeWinter's T waves, and a T wave inversion in aVL. We'll dive into the science behind the patterns, look at some of the original literature identifying these patterns, and walk through some cases discussing the patient from initial presentation all the way through the cath lab findings.

Join GSACEP on April 22 for this engaging webinar featuring Dr. Lloyd Tannenbaum, an expert in emergency medicine and ECG education with a strong military medicine background. A graduate of Jefferson Medical College, Dr. Tannenbaum completed his residency at Brooke Army Medical Center (BAMC) and remained on faculty as an ACGME core educator and Associate Program Director for the Emergency Medicine Residency during his active duty service.

Drawing on his experience as a military educator, textbook author (EKG Teaching Rounds), and creator of “ECG Teaching Cases,” Dr. Tannenbaum breaks down challenging tracings into practical, high-yield insights you can apply in real time.
